ORDER
PER CURIAM
AND NOW, this 28th day of February, 2017, the Application for Leave to File
Original Process is GRANTED, the Petition for Writ of Mandamus is DENIED.
The Prothonotary is DIRECTED to strike the name of the jurist from the caption.
